Analysis

Thailand recorded 7,331 USD for gross domestic product — value us$ per capita in 2024.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 2.1% on the previous year and up 26.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, gross domestic product — value us$ per capita in Thailand peaked at 7,606 USD in 2019 and was at its lowest, 205.47 USD, in 1970.

That places Thailand 112th out of 195 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Gross Domestic Product — Value US$ per capita in Thailand, year by year

Annual values for Gross Domestic Product — Value US$ per capita in Thailand, 1970 to 2024.
Year USD Change
1970 205.47 USD
1971 208.18 USD +1.3%
1972 224.73 USD +7.9%
1973 288.34 USD +28.3%
1974 357.58 USD +24.0%
1975 379.02 USD +6.0%
1976 422.68 USD +11.5%
1977 481.34 USD +13.9%
1978 571.6 USD +18.8%
1979 638.1 USD +11.6%
1980 734.46 USD +15.1%
1981 775.32 USD +5.6%
1982 798.37 USD +3.0%
1983 856.96 USD +7.3%
1984 877.69 USD +2.4%
1985 801.92 USD -8.6%
1986 872.67 USD +8.8%
1987 1,006 USD +15.2%
1988 1,206 USD +20.0%
1989 1,390 USD +15.2%
1990 1,616 USD +16.2%
1991 1,820 USD +12.6%
1992 2,045 USD +12.4%
1993 2,245 USD +9.8%
1994 2,518 USD +12.1%
1995 2,864 USD +13.8%
1996 3,055 USD +6.6%
1997 2,473 USD -19.0%
1998 1,848 USD -25.3%
1999 2,033 USD +10.0%
2000 2,006 USD -1.3%
2001 1,890 USD -5.8%
2002 2,090 USD +10.6%
2003 2,348 USD +12.3%
2004 2,642 USD +12.5%
2005 2,868 USD +8.6%
2006 3,331 USD +16.2%
2007 3,919 USD +17.6%
2008 4,309 USD +10.0%
2009 4,135 USD -4.0%
2010 4,974 USD +20.3%
2011 5,374 USD +8.0%
2012 5,726 USD +6.5%
2013 6,018 USD +5.1%
2014 5,801 USD -3.6%
2015 5,689 USD -1.9%
2016 5,834 USD +2.5%
2017 6,413 USD +9.9%
2018 7,100 USD +10.7%
2019 7,606 USD +7.1%
2020 6,986 USD -8.2%
2021 7,058 USD +1.0%
2022 6,909 USD -2.1%
2023 7,182 USD +3.9%
2024 7,331 USD +2.1%

The FAOSTAT Macro Indicators database provides a selection of country-level macro indicators relating to total economy (Gross Domestic Product, Gross Fixed Capital Formation); agriculture activity; agriculture, forestry and fishing activity; total manufacturing activity; manufacturing of food products and beverages activity; manufacturing activity of tobacco products; and manufacturing activity of food, beverage and tobacco products.It releases time series for a selection of National Accounts variables, including gross domestic product, gross fixed capital formation, industry-level value added and gross output. The database also proposes additional indicators such as gross domestic product per capita, year-on-year growth rates and measures of industry contribution to gross domestic product. All data relating to Gross Domestic Product, Gross Fixed Capital Formation, agriculture, forestry and fishing activity, and to total manufacturing activity originates from the United Nations Statistics Division (UNSD) National Accounts Estimates of Main Aggregates database, which consists of a complete and consistent set of time series of the main National Accounts aggregates of all UN Members States and other territories in the world for which National Accounts information is available. The UNSD database's content is based on the countries' official National Accounts data reported to UNSD through the annual National Accounts Questionnaire, supplemented with data estimates for any years and countries with incomplete or inconsistent information (See http://unstats.un.org/unsd/snaama/Introduction.asp). Data series relating to the sub-industry Agriculture activity are obtained from the UNSD national accounts Official Country Data databases while series on the Manufacturing activity of food and beverages products, manufacturing activity of tobacco products and manufacturing activity of food, beverages and tobacco products originates from the United Nations Industrial Development Organization (UNIDO) INDSTAT2 database. In order to ensure that sub-industry series are consistent in levels with National Accounts based series, which is needed to support comparability across industries (agriculture vs. agro-industry and sub-industries), UNIDO originating series are rescaled on UNSD National Accounts Estimates of Main Aggregates data series (See Section 17.5 for a more detailed description of the data processing steps).
